Clemson University is a Class B member of the Inter-university Consortium for Political and Social Research. ICPSR is located in the Institute for Social Research, University of Michigan and is a membership-based, not-for-profit, organization serving member colleges and universities in the United States and abroad by providing:
- Access to a large archive of machine-readable social science data
- Training facilities in basic and advanced techniques of quantitative social analysis
- Resources that facilitate the use of advanced computer technology by social scientists
